A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, links the dishwasher to a water source. A plumber can guarantee that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and also water resource if you get a brand-new supply line. An expert plumber can examine it to ensure that it's in great condition and also does not have any type of leaks if you make a decision to utilize an existing supply line.

Installing a Dish Washer Needs a Variety of Devices


If you do not have a variety of tools on hand, you may need to make a trip to Lowe's or House Depot. To mount a dishwasher, you need the following t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
